Day 2 – Delhi
Delhi – the capital of Republic of India. The city
has thousands of stories since Mahabharata Period to Mughal
period upto british period. It was destroyed, plundered and
reconstructed several times. It is the third largest city
of India. City has several monuments like Red Fort, Jama Masjid
in old city, India gate – Arc of triumph for Indian
Soldiers, Parliament house, Presidents house, Qutub Minar,
Lotus temple or Bahawi temple, humayun’s tomb etc.
Day 3 – Delhi – Jaipur
Jaipur is world famous as pink city of India. The city was
planned by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h a great astronomer. Jaipur
offers variety of things to the taste of tourists –
Grand forts of Amber , Jaigarh, and Nahargarh, beautiful City
palace and observatory – Jantar Mantar. There are Royal
Cenotaphs at Gaittor worth visiting.

Day 5 – Jaipur – Bharatpur – Fatehpur Sikri
- Agra
On the way visit to Fatehpur Sikri.
Fatehpur sikri was constructed by Akbar in 15th century at
the distance of about 40 kms from Agra. The sikri has famous
Dargah of Khwaja Salim Chishti. The emperor got a son by the
blessings of the Saint – who was named after him and
he decided to change his capital from Agra to Fatehpur Sikri.
After the complete construction, it was found out the city
experience severe scarcity of water. So after few months capital
was again shifted to Agra.
Presently city offers beautiful dargah (mosque) carved out
of Marble, and beautiful fort. One of the most wonderful construction
is of Buland Darwaja – Highest gateway (179 metres)
in Asia. There are different palaces like Birbal mahal, Jodhabai’s
Palace which are finest examples of Hindu-persian architecture.

Day 6 – Agra
In the morning visit Agra, the city world famous for Tajmahal
– the dream in Marble. City offers several great monuments
constructed during the mughal period like Huge Agra fort ,
Ita-ma-daula’s tomb, Royal mughal gardens at Dayal Bagh.
It offers variety of things to the visitors from old traditional
things in the market to ultra modern shopping complexes.
